Interesting Alabama squad that year. 6 of their 7 wins they gave up less than 10 points on defense. In fact, of those 6 wins, they gave up 29 points total. They gave up 28 alone to a Vandy squad they beat by 21. Of those 7 wins, they gave up an average of 8.14 points on defense.
Their 4 regular season losses were by a combined 17 points which is an average of 4.25 points. Of those games, their average scoring was 13.25 and giving up 17.5.
Of the 4 regular season losses, the first 3 were by a combined 8 points. Their "worst" loss was an 0-9 loss to Penn State.
Of course, their worst loss of the season happened to be against one of Louisville's best teams of all time in the Fiesta Bowl; a UL squad that went 10-1-1 lead by former Miami national champion coach Howard Schnellenberger.
Not counting the Fiesta Bowl loss, that Alabama team sure looked better than a 7-4 regular season squad considering how all the games were relatively close, especially the losses.
It was also Stallings first year.
